This last week in the tech world ended up being much bigger than it began. We discuss Microsoft’s proposal to purchase Yahoo!, Amazon’s acquirement of Audible, Pirate Bay charged with copyright infringement, Facebook apps on any website, and the announcement of Digg Town Hall.
